In 1994, two technology contractors saw a gap in the market for a technical recruitment agency in South Wales. Based on their own poor experiences with agencies IntaPeople's foundation has always been delivering exceptional customer service.
IntaPeople is more than just an IT and engineering recruitment agency; they are passionate about making a difference.
Their desire to create meaningful
relationships has allowed us to transform
thousands of careers and support the growth of
UK businesses for 25 years.
Based in
Cardiff since 1994, they have outlasted multiple
recessions and market shifts. This is due to
their commitment to excellence and industry
knowledge, which flows through everything they
do.
The experienced recruiters are
trained to be experts in their field, focusing
on vertical markets including software
development, life sciences, cybersecurity,
engineering, and IT infrastructure. 25 years on,
the tech recruitment world has changed and
advanced to keep up with the markets that
IntaPeople serves but their commitment to
excellence has remained consistent.
As a company that prides itself on delivering
exceptional levels of customer service, finding
a supplier that aligned with IntaPeople's
beliefs was proving to be a challenge.
Faced with spiralling costs and
faltering customer service delivered by
their current leased line supplier, it
was clear that IntaPeople needed a
change.
Alongside this their incumbent system was
struggling to deliver the speeds and
functionality that IntaPeople required,
particularly when the Pandemic struck and a
rapid move to remote working was required.
After speaking to Atlas Support a simple yet
effective solution was recommended, designed to
give them high-speed connectivity but also
remote working capabilities to support their
20-strong team.
Reconfiguration of
IntaPeople's existing Mitel system meant they
could effectively work remotely without the need
for expensive new equipment - keeping their
recruiters and customers connected when access
to the offices was restricted.
The
addition of new, faster, leased lines and SIP
trunks further improved IntaPeople's
connectivity. Providing them with a reliable and
robust connection suitable for handling high
volumes of calls and providing them with
unrivalled reliability and guaranteed speeds.
SIP also provides IntaPeople with a future-proof
means of communication, providing a replacement
for traditional ISDN well ahead of the 2025
switch-off.
Through our work together IntaPeople have been able to take advantage of the following results;
Time Savings: With a dedicated account manager and one point of contact, making changes or getting support is quick and easy.
Remote working capabilities: Remote working is now a viable option for all the team, providing them with the necessary business continuity throughout the pandemic and beyond allowing the team to embrace the hybrid-working model of the future.
Cost Savings: A modernised telephony solution provides cost savings, further enhanced by the use of leased lines and no complex costly onsite equipment. SIP also provides the next step in IntaPeoples move to the full-fibre future.
Usability: Between their on-site expertise managing/configuring the Mitel system and support from Atlas Support’s engineers when required, IntaPeople has an agile and flexible solution in which they can easily adapt to fit the changing needs of their business.
